Я хочу отключить возможность веб-сайта проверять фокус

#javascript #onfocus

#javascript #onfocus

Вопрос:

Ссылка на код — https://live .allenbpms.in/vc/impAppVendorVcBundle-ba46108f37.min.js Это довольно долго, но, но я думаю, что это на

 function $e() {
  window.onfocus = function() {
    e.vcNamespace.chatAttendeesCount < 100 amp;amp; (Logger.info("---------------onfocus"),
      l.sendMessage(angular.toJson({
        msgtype: "chat",
        subtype: "user-focus",
        userid: e.vcNamespace.user.userId,
        chatId: e.vcNamespace.user.chatId,
        focus: !0,
        time: Date.now() / 1e3,
        exampleid: e.unitInfo.exampleId
      })))
  }
}
 

Комментарии:

1. Пожалуйста, объясните, какие функции вы хотите отключить. Фрагмент кода не объясняет это сам по себе и зачем возвращать true?

2. Чего вы на самом деле пытаетесь достичь? Если вам не нужен обработчик событий onfocus, почему бы просто не удалить его? Или это не ваш сайт? Затем вам нужно будет ввести скрипт…

3. @derpirscher Я пытаюсь внедрить скрипт на другой сайт. По сути, всякий раз, когда я меняю вкладки, вкладка выгружается, поэтому мне приходится загружать ее снова.

4. Вы можете просто переопределить window.onfocus = undefined в консоли разработчика. Но это, конечно, длится только до тех пор, пока вы не закроете вкладку. Если вы хотите автоматически вводить какой-либо скрипт, вам понадобится плагин для браузера…